Dahanu

Villas, Farm Stay and Camping at Dahanu



Beachside Villa Click here for details







Located in Palghar District, Off Manor Wada Road
5 minutes' walk from Pinjal River






No comments:

Post a Comment

For queries connect with info@natureknights.net

Note: Only a member of this blog may post a comment.